In 1989, the Board of Directors of United Way of Monroe County created the Mary Alice Gray Memorial Award for Extraordinary Service to United Way. Mary Alice Gray served on the Board of Directors from 1978-1983 and was President during 1980 and 1981. This annual award is given to United Way volunteers who best personify the dedication and commitment of Mary Alice Gray.
